Description
This is Amendment 2 against W91WAW-10-R-0016. The purpose of this amendment is to provide Contractor Questions and Government Responses to the Sources Sought Notice. The Sources Sought closing date is 18 December 2009. Please submit capability packages to Ms. Regina Foston (Contract Specialist) via electronic-mail (FostonR@conus.army.mil). Telephone inquiries will not be accepted. Contractor Questions and Government Responses: Contractor Question 1: The Pre-Solicitation Opportunity Summary Report indicates Place of PerformanceContractors Site, US. The Draft PWS (para 1.4) identifies Work Location: Work shall be performed at the Government Site. and Part 4 of the Draft PWS suggests the Place of Performance will be determined upon award of the contract. Since offered price is heavily dependent upon Place of Performance, will the RFP identify Place of Performance? Government Response #1: The Contractors Site, US is the correct answer. Contractor Question #2: Para 1.3 (Scope and Objectives)Based on the statement Provide program awareness and information to enhance academic communitys world wide acceptance of college credit recommendations shown on AARTS transcript. Will the RFP identify the expected level of effort associated with this seemingly unbounded marketing initiative? Government Response #2: Yes, we can specify the production of the tri-fold brochure and its forwarding to the Defense Activity for non-Traditional Educational Support (DANTES) for distribution to the field. Contractor Question #3: Will the RFP identify any/all automated tool(s) currently being used to assist the soldier and counselors in conducting their assessments? Government Answer #3: This is more a function of the AARTS Operations Center and its website. Contractor Question #4: Para 1.3 (Scope and Objectives)Are advisory services the same as counseling services? Government Response #4: That may be a matter of interpretation; however, the contractor would not normally do educational counseling for soldiers. They only advise Soldiers concerning the status of pending course evaluations. That is the duty of the Army Education Centers (AECs). Contractor Question #5: Question (b) reads& How can your company guarantee that the labor categories will be in place upon contract award? Will the RFP identify the specific labor categories the Government anticipates are necessary and their associated expected level of effort? Government Answer #5: We can!
